Four-channel, general-purpose CMOS operational amplifier featuring a 710kHz bandwidth and 0.55V/µs slew rate. This device offers low input offset voltage of 950µV and minimal input bias current of 800pA. It operates from a 2.2V to 16V supply range, with a typical operating supply voltage of 8V and a supply current of 1mA. The amplifier boasts a 70dB common mode rejection ratio and a 50mA output current per channel. Packaged in a 14-SOIC, this RoHS compliant component is suitable for operation between -40°C and 125°C.
